I have created by custom UIButton for iPad application.

Now for specific reasons, I want to hide those buttons. To do that I am using following code:

NSMutableArray *viewArray = [[NSMutableArray alloc] init];

    // Get all the windows
    for (UIWindow *window in [[UIApplication sharedApplication] windows])
    {
      // check for main screen
      if (![window respondsToSelector:@selector(screen)] ||
          [window screen] == [UIScreen mainScreen])
      {

        // check for all the subviews available in window
        for (UIView * view in [window subviews]) {

          // check whether it supports this method
          if ([view respondsToSelector:@selector(isKindOfClass:)]) {

            // type cast to button
            //          UIButton *btn = (UIButton *)view;

            // if its type of my custom button class
            if ([[view class] isKindOfClass:[DINNextLTProBoldButton class]]) {

              // hide view and add to array
              [view setHidden:YES];
              [viewArray addObject:view];
            }
          }
        }
      }
    }

But I am not able to get my custom buttons in this array. It stays empty only even thought the view which is being appeared on window/screen have those buttons.

Where I am going wrong? Please guide me.

    try this (untested, but it gives the basic idea)

    - (void)hideViewOfClass:(Class)clazz inHeirarchyOfView:(UIView *)view
    {
        for (UIView *subview in [view subviews])
        {
            if ([subview isKindOfClass:clazz])
                subview.hidden = YES;
            else 
                [self hideViewOfClass:clazz inHeirarchyOfView:subview];
        }
    }
    

    call this function at first like:

    for (UIWindow *window in [[UIApplication sharedApplication] windows])
        [self hideViewOfClass:[DINNextLTProBoldButton class] inHeirarchyOfView:window];
